But here's the full story:
A month ago, I walked into my shop to start another normal day.
By that night, I learned I had 48 hours to close forever.
No warning. No conversation. Just a sudden announcement that left 10 small businesses, including mine, without a home. It felt like losing a piece of myself.
But what happened next changed everything.
I shared the news on Instagram, not expecting much. Within hours, the post reached over 40,000 people. By 6pm on our last night, we were completely sold out. My inbox filled with opportunities, collaborations, and people asking how they could help and donate. In that moment, I realized: The shop closed, but the vision didn’t. What We’re Building Next
1. A Nationwide Pop-Up Tour (2026):
New York and Atlanta are confirmed, with more cities on the way. These aren’t simple pop-ups; they’re immersive, curated Shuga x Ice experiences.
2. Local Pop-Ups, Events, Pickup/Delivery & Shipping:
We’re securing commercial kitchen access so our community can continue to order pints, specials, and book us for catering/events and pop-ups while we search for our next home.
3. Nationwide Shipping:
We planned to launch nationwide shipping this Thanksgiving - one of our biggest dreams yet, but the closure didn’t cancel that vision - it simply delayed it. With your help, we can rebuild our shipping system and bring Shuga x Ice to doorsteps across the country the way we intended. This is still happening.
4. Our Forever Home:
We’re working toward a permanent space built with stability, growth, and longevity in mind. A space worthy of this vision.
